Abstract
There was a remarkable difference in the flap thickness of microkeratomes of the same make and model. This emphasizes the need to measure intraoperative flap thickness and to evaluate every microkeratome separately. Factors affecting flap thickness seem to be more device dependent than patient related; obtaining flap thickness in the first eye did not enable predictions of the flap thickness in the fellow eye.
